For this 10th episode of Summit to Talk About I met up with Neil Read in Bushy Park in London. Surrounded by nature, Neil shares his own 'Walk for your Wellbeing' story of living with depression and how getting into the outdoors and hiking has helped him.
He is now an ambassador for My Black Dog, a charity doing great things to help others who are struggling with their own mental health through peer support.
Neil has trekked Hadrian's wall and this year will embark on a 171 mile trek in under 6 days to raise money and awareness for suicide prevention.
